Sean Lewis is a fine art landscape photographer based in Sussex. His aim is to show the essence of nature as an art form. Through his work he strives to move beyond the contraints of the illustrative and find balance and harmony on the borderline between the descriptive and the evocative, essentially to translate the mood and feeling of the inner exploration of the landscape and his connection with it via form, texture and light.
Sean studied photography [mostly black and white] in Brighton in the late nineties and acquired a good knowledge in technique, theory, developing and printing. In more recent years, Sean has discovered the unique and unparalleled quality of velvia colour transparency film and he now works exclusivly with 5x4” large format camera equipment working in colour and black and white, which ever suits the mood of the scene. Sean has had work published in books and magazines, and he is currently working around southern England especially along the coastline. Through his photography Sean hopes to communicate his vision of exploration, discovery and beauty within the landscape. The prints available are limited editions of 50 per image.
